Why Choose a Heavy Duty Pool Ladder?

Heavy duty pool ladders differ significantly from standard versions by offering a higher weight capacity, robust construction, and enhanced safety features. These ladders are designed to withstand daily use, various climates, and users of all ages and body types. They're essential for commercial pools and crucial for families with small children or elderly members, providing peace of mind for everyone.[10][11]

Key Features of a Heavy Duty Pool Ladder

- Supports up to 400 lbs or more

- Extra-wide, textured, non-slip steps

- Reinforced, corrosion-resistant materials

- Sturdy handrails and top platform

- Customizable step count and width for specific pool styles[11][12]

- Compatible with above-ground and in-ground pools

- Stability reinforcements (e.g., sand-filled legs, deck bolts)

Materials Selection: Professional-Grade Options

Metal Components

Stainless Steel Tubing: Premier choice for resistance to rust, structural strength, and longevity, especially in saltwater and high-chlorine environments.[13]

Powder-Coated Steel: Offers extra rust resistance and aesthetics, available in multiple colors.[12]

Resin and Plastics

High-Density Resin: Lightweight, cool to the touch, and corrosion-proof, ideal for step surfaces and handrails in hot climates.[12][13]

HDPE (High-Density Polyethylene): Used in some commercial grade ladders for its non-reactivity and resilience.

Wood and PVC

Pressure-Treated Timber/Composite Wood: Best for custom builds; strong, widely available, and affordable when properly finished.[14][15]

PVC Pipe: Suitable for DIY lightweight ladders; requires careful reinforcement.[15][16]

Fasteners and Add-Ons

Stainless Steel Bolts/Deck Screws: Impervious to moisture and pool chemicals.

Non-Slip Tape/Grip Pads: Essential for every step surface, available in peel-and-stick or adhesive types.

Cinder Blocks/Concrete Pads: Often used as base support for added stability on soft ground.[17][15]

Step-by-Step Building Guide

1. Planning Your Ladder

- Measure Your Pool Wall Height: Common wall heights are 48", 52", or 54". Sketched design should specify number of steps (3–6), width (18–24"), and handrail length.[6][14][15]

- Select Materials: Refer to your pool's climate, size, and whether you prefer metal, resin, or wood components.

- Gather Tools: Hacksaw, screwdriver, wrench, drill, measuring tape, sandpaper, sealant/paint, grip tape.

2. Cutting and Preparing Parts

- Side Rails: Cut two rails to desired ladder length. For metal rails, use a hacksaw; for wood, apply smooth cuts and sand edges.[18]

- Steps/Treads: Cut non-slip step boards to length; resin steps may come pre-molded to size.[19][15]

- Handrails: Create handrails from bent stainless steel tubing or solid wood, ensuring ergonomic grip.[14][15]

3. Assembling Frame

- Attach Treads: Lay rails parallel, mark step spacing (10–12" apart), pre-drill holes, and attach steps securely with bolts/screws.[1][14]

- Install Handrails: Mount handrails at a 45° angle for safe support, securing with matching fasteners. Use washers to ensure tightness.[1][6]

- Create Top Platform: A flat platform at the pool's ledge offers improved user stability; bolt securely to rails.

4. Stability Enhancements

- Sand Fill Legs: Pour dry sand into hollow ladder legs to add downward weight and prevent floating.[1]

- Deck Mounts and Base Pads: Install anchor brackets or use cinder/concrete pads to anchor ladder base.[15]

- Entrapment Barriers: Attach if included/to minimize swimmer risk under ladder area.[1]

5. Fine Finishing

- Non-Slip Steps: Adhesive grip pads, resin step covers, or texture paint for anti-slip surfaces.

- Edge Smoothing: Sand or file down all edges—particularly on wooden or resin ladders.

- Seal/Coat Surfaces: Use waterproof sealant or marine-grade paint for all exposed wood or non-stainless metal.

6. Fitting and Inspection

- Height Adjustment: Trim rails as needed to fit your exact pool wall.[6]

- Attach to Pool Wall: Bolt top platform to pool deck, drill pilot holes if necessary.[1]

- Final Check: Test all fasteners, apply downward pressure, and inspect each step for anchoring integrity.[3][8]

Advanced Safety and Maintenance Tips

1. Regular Inspection: Check all bolts, steps, and handrails before each swim season and after heavy use. Tighten, replace, or repair immediately.[13][1]

2. Seasonal Removal: Protect materials from harsh winter conditions or storms by removing or covering ladder.[1]

3. Avoid Diving: Never dive or jump from a pool ladder; clearly label safety warnings.[4]

4. Weighted Legs: Always fill any hollow legs with sand, water, or mount weights; this keeps ladder base stable.[15][1]

5. Entrapment Prevention: Use barrier attachments to block off gaps beneath steps.[1]

6. Outdoor Longevity: Prefer stainless steel or resin for outdoor pools, as untreated metals and unsealed wood degrade rapidly.

Manufacturer's Perspective and International OEM Considerations

For factories and professional OEM suppliers, producing heavy duty pool ladders requires strict adherence to international standards like ASTM F1346 and EN 16582. Automated cutting, welding, and molding machines ensure tight tolerances and repeatable quality. Surface finishing is vital—electropolished stainless steel, UV-resistant resin, and robotically applied anti-slip coatings guarantee durability and user safety.

Chinese manufacturers specializing in sand filter systems, pumps, LED pool lights, and accessories frequently offer custom ladder designs with client-branded features. OEM orders often require technical documentation, full CAD drawings, and sample reviews. Export standards require robust packaging, detailed assembly instructions, and support for variable pool heights and local code compliance.[1]

Bonus: Popular Design Variations

Platform Ladder (with Deck Integration)

- Features a large top deck platform for easy access and poolside seating

- Requires deck anchors and extra-wide step pads

Flip-Up Ladder

- Step section lifts when not in use, preventing unauthorized access and adding security[6]

- Out-of-the-way design for pool cleaning and safety

A-Frame and Double-Sided Styles

- Perfect for above-ground pools, these ladders have step access from both sides, allowing easy entry/exit

Environmental Adaptations

- For seaside or saltwater pools, always select 316-grade stainless steel for maximum corrosion resistance.[13]

- In cold climates, removable ladders are preferable to prevent freeze damage.

- For high-traffic commercial pools, industrial resin and anti-microbial coatings extend product life and hygiene.

Maintenance and Care

- Rinse ladder after each swim session, particularly in saltwater.[13]

- Inspect for rust, corrosion, and hardware loosening monthly.

- Reapply sealant, paint, or non-slip covers yearly, or as needed per manufacturer guidelines.

- Store indoors or under a pool cover in the off-season for maximum lifespan.

Frequently Asked Questions (FAQ)

1. What is the recommended material for a heavy duty pool ladder?

Stainless steel and high-grade resin are safest and most durable. Pressure-treated wood and reinforced PVC are viable for DIY builds when properly finished and sealed.[20][12][15][13]

2. How do I anchor my ladder securely?

Use sand-filled legs, concrete base pads, and bolt-on brackets to secure your ladder and prevent unwanted movement or floating.[17][15][1]

3. What should the weight capacity be for heavy duty pool ladders?

A minimum of 300 lbs, but commercial or high-traffic ladders are typically rated for 350–400 lbs.[21][10][11]

4. How often should a pool ladder be inspected?

At the start of every swimming season and monthly during heavy use; tighten all fittings and check step surface for wear.[13][1]

5. Can I customize ladder height and step width?

Yes; measure your pool wall and desired step width, then trim rails and space steps to match your design.[6][15][1]
